The Bink Bruin is dark brown to black, with a mahogany tinge and a decent mocha head full of tiny bubbles. The smell is both fruity and yeasty, with the dark malts presenting as dark dried fruits and mild sugary caramel.
There are malty caramel flavours, as well as sweet fruits. But these are balanced by the hop bitterness, which is more than normal for a Belgian dark ale. The bite of the hops leaves thisbeer with a refreshingly dry finish, avoiding the cloying sweetness that some dark beers display.
At 5.5% ABV, this beer definitely punches above its weight in flavour and is truly a satisfying drop.
